Book Overview

by Jay Hogan (Author)

Sometimes you have to lose everything to find the one thing that matters most.

The day begins like any other-canoodling with my live-in boyfriend, making weekend plans over breakfast, and arguing about the apartment renovation list. Then my best friend and business partner texts, begging me to ditch Thad so we can meet for a lunchtime quickie in our usual spot.

Small problem: I'm Thad. Oops.

By midday, I've lost one ratface boyfriend, my best mate, the company I built from scratch, and the courage to hire a hitman-although I'm not ruling that last one out just yet. The future I had neatly mapped out is now toast. In its place, a laundry list of awkward questions, rumours, and pitying looks.

And so, I do what I do best. I run-my crumbling life fading in the rearview mirror. No plan. No destination. Just a road. Through a forest. In a storm. To a dog. And a shed. And a towering man who smells of pine, rain, and, mercifully, bacon.

There's dirt under my nails, something growing in my heart, and suddenly I'm breathing again. Breathing and smiling and lying, lying, lying. To the man I'm falling for. To the people I care about. To myself, most of all.

But for every lie, there's a reckoning. And when the truth catches up, and the heart is truly at stake, there's no running anymore.
